Hi Joel,
The two classes that you are looking for are in the package =
org.eclipse.hyades.use.cases.auto.common under the 'src' folder.
VerifyHookUtil is used to provide convenient methods for extracting =
widgets from shells/views/editors
Logger is used to log debug messages
The verification hook classes are in package =
org.eclipse.hyades.use.cases.auto.profiling.logging. The class names =
should correspond to the
test suite names under the 'gui' folder.
